书山有路勤为径,学海无涯苦作舟! 住在富人区的她考研考博-考博英语-华东师范大学考前自测提分卷(含答案详解)一.综合题(共10题)1.单选题When Mr. Li writes an article, he always keep several dictionaries().问题1选项A.under his handsB.by handC.out of handD.at hand【答案】D【解析】词组辨析题。by hand用手;out of hand脱手、无法控制;at hand在手边。句意:李先生写文章时,手边总有几本词典。选项D符合句意。2.单选题Though()in San Francisco, Dave Mitchell had always preferred to record the plain facts of small-town life.问题1选项A.raisedB.grownC.developedD.cultivated【答案】A【解析】考査动词辨析。raised养育;grown増长;developed培养,发展;cultivated耕作,种植。句意:虽然戴夫米切尔在旧金山长大,但他更喜欢记录小镇生活的平凡生活。选项A符合句意。3.单选题Its()in the regulation that you can take 20 kilos of luggage with you.问题1选项A.laid uponB.laid outC.laid upD.laid down【答案】D【解析】词组辨析题。lay upon随而定,把重点放在;lay out展示,安排;lay up贮存,搁置,卧床不起;lay down放下,制定,铺设,主张。句意:条例规定您只能携带20公斤的行李。选项D符合句意。4.单选题If you drive a motorcar to the danger of the public, you may make yourself()a heavy fine.问题1选项A.liable toB.acquainted withC.alert toD.relevant to【答案】A【解析】liable to容易;acquainted with熟悉,了解,与.相识;alert to警告;relevant to与.有关的,相应的。句意:如果你驾驶一辆汽车对大众造成了危害,你有可能会受到重罚。选项A符合句意。5.单选题The students in the dormitories were forbidden, unless they had special passes, ()after 11 p.m.问题1选项A.staying outB.from staying outC.against staying outD.to stay out【答案】D【解析】unless they had special passes为插入语,可忽略不看。forbid的常用搭配是forbid sb. to do sth./ forbid doing sth.所以选项D正确。6.单选题He says he hasnt got any money()in fact hes got thousands of dollars in his account.问题1选项A.asB.sinceC.whileD.for【答案】C【解析】句意:他说他一分钱都没拿到,但实际上,他的账户进账几千美元。上下有转折的关系,用while更适合。7.单选题Efforts to educate people about the risks of substance abuse seem to deter some people from using dangerous substances, if such efforts are realistic about what is genuinely dangerous and what is not. Observed declines in the use of such drugs as LSD, PCP, and Quaaludes since the early 1970s are probably related to increased awareness of the risks of their use, and some of this awareness was the result of warnings about these drugs in “underground” papers read by drug users. Such sources are influential, because they do not give a simple “all drugs are terrible for you” message. Drug users know there are big variations in danger among drugs, and anti-drug education that ignores or denies this is likely to be ridiculed. This is illustrated by the popularity among young marijuana users of Reefer Madness, a widely unrealistic propaganda film against marijuana made in the 1930s. This film made the rounds of college campuses in the 1970s and joined rock-music videos on cable televisions MTV in the 1980s. Instead of deterring marijuana use, it became a cult film among users, many of whom got high to watch it.Although persuasion can work for some people if it is balanced and reasonable, other people seem immune to the most reasoned educational efforts. Millions have started smoking even though the considerable health risks of smoking have been well known and publicized for years. Moreover, the usefulness of education lies in primary prevention: prevention of abuse among those who presently have no problem. Hence, Bomiers (1978, p. 150) contention that “if the Pepsi generation can be persuaded to drink pop wine, they can be persuaded not to drink it while driving” is probably not correct, since most drunken driving is done by people who already have significant drinking problems, and hence seem not to be dissuaded even by much stronger measures such as loss of a drivers license.1.According to the passage, up to now, anti-drug education()2.The film Reefer Madness mentioned in the passage()3.The message all drugs are terrible for you is not influential because()4.According to the passage, which of the following statements is NOT true?5.The best title for the passage would be ()问题1选项A.has made all people see the danger of drugsB.has succeeded in dissuading people from using drugsC.has been effective only to a certain degreeD.has proved to be a total failure问题2选项A.effectively deterred marijuana useB.was rejected by young marijuana usersC.did not picture the danger of marijuana realisticallyD.was welcomed by marijuana users because it told them how to get high问题3选项A.it ignores the fact that drugs vary greatly in dangerB.it gives a false account of the risks of drug useC.some drugs are good for healthD.it does not appear in underground papers问题4选项A.Sometimes balanced and reasonable anti-drug persuasion is influential to some people.B.Most drug users are ignorant of the danger of drugs.C.Punishments such as loss of a drivers license do not seem to be an effective way to stop drunken driving.D.Primary prevention is a useful principle to be followed in anti-drug education.问题5选项A.Are All Drugs Terrible for You?B.Do People Believe What Underground Papers Say?C.Is There an Increased Awareness of the Risks of Drugs?D.Can Persuasion Reduce Drug Abuse?【答案】第1题:C第2题:C第3题:A第4题:B第5题:D【解析】1.细节事实题。根据第二段的第一句“Although persuasion can work for some people if it is balanced and reasonable, other people seem immune to the most reasoned educational efforts.”虽然平衡和合理的说服对一些人来说是有效的,但另一些人似乎不受这些最合乎逻辑的教育工作的影响。也就是说反毒品教育只起到了一部分的作用,选项C符合原文。2.语义题。根据第一段的最后一句“Instead of deterring marijuana use, it became a cult film among users, many of whom got high to watch it.”这部电影非但没有阻止人们吸食大麻,反而成为了用户中的一部邪典电影,很多人为了看这部电影而兴奋不已。选项C符合原文。3.细节事实题。根据第一段“Drug users know there are big variations in danger among drugs, and anti-drug education that ignores or denies this is likely to be ridiculed.”吸毒者知道毒品存在着巨大的危险,忽视或否认这一点的禁毒教育是很可笑的。选项A符合原文。4.细节事实题。根据原文“Drug users know there are big variations in danger among drugs,”吸毒者知道毒品存在着巨大的危险。所以选项B错误。5.主旨大意题。第一段讲了禁毒教育并没有起到很好的效果,第二段讲了劝说只是对部分人起到作用。所以本文主要是讲劝说能减少毒品滥用吗?选项D正确。8.单选题My neighbors on either side of me have painted their houses,()of course makes my house look shabbier than it really is.问题1选项A.thatB.asC.whoD.which【答案】D【解析】考查非限定性定语从句。which指代前面的整个句子,对主句起附加说明的作用。句意:我两边的邻居都粉刷了他们的房子,这使我的房子看起来比实际更破旧。9.单选题Dont worry. If this does not work, there are other methods we can().问题1选项A.fall behindB.fall outC.fall throughD.fall back on【答案】D【解析】词义辨析题。fall behind落后;fall out脱落;fall through失败;fall back on求助于。句意:不用担心。如果这个办法没用的话,我们还能求助于其它办法。10.单选题It is ridiculous that we().问题1选项A.are short of water in a country where it is always rainingB.be short of water in a country where it is always rainingC.might be short of water in a country where it is always rainingD.could be short of water in a country where it is always raining【答案】B【解析】考査虚拟语气。It is/was+adj/n+that+主语+虚拟语气。that后面的从句用should+原形,其中should可省略,选项B就是省略了should的虚拟语气,所以选B。
